Aquil JaisonAquil Jaison
Great experience and fast service here. Just one thing to note - if you’re going for a walk-in do not wait by the door outside, but use the door in the corner under the address -3699 Millwoods Rd. and lineup inside. The door with service canada written above is an exit only door and no point in waiting there. But other than that, the whole process was easy and smooth.

Came in for a passport renewal knowing it would be a wait. Staff repeatedly told a portion of the line that it would be a 3 hour wait and to "plan our day accordingly". No problem, I expected that. After 3 1/2 hours I checked my place in line, 13 in front still, will be another hour. Ok, I can still do that. An hour later I check again, 9th in line! I took 15 minutes trying to decide what to do because I couldn't stay another 2 - 3 hours and in that time I went from 9th to 10th because an appointment came in! I understand that you can't fully predict how long the wait will be but here is the issue. The SAME employee continued to tell the line of new people coming in that it would be a 3 hour wait which is impossible! I was there at open and they close at 4:30, I would have been lucky to see anyone before close! Had I been able to "plan my day accordingly" I would have left knowing I didn't have 8 hours to spare. Want to know your real wait time? Once checked in, ask how many people are in front of you and then count how many agents are working (they come out to call the next person). Each person in line will take about 30 minutes with an agent so divide the people in front of you by the agents times 30 minutes. That might be a bit more accurate wait time and that's if you don't have a bunch of people with multiple passport applications (there was a lady in front of me with 7). Hopefully this will help you "plan your day...
